Support Beam Repair in Wilmington, NC
Support beam repair services involve assessing and restoring the structural integrity of support beams that are essential for holding up floors, ceilings, and roofs within a property. These repairs cover a variety of projects, including fixing or replacing damaged, rotting, or sagging beams caused by age, moisture, or other structural issues. Homeowners typically seek support beam repair when signs such as uneven floors, cracks in walls, or sagging ceilings become noticeable, as these can indicate compromised structural support that needs attention to ensure safety and stability.
Before requesting support beam repair, property owners should understand the extent of the damage and whether it affects other parts of the structure. It is helpful to identify any visible signs of deterioration, such as mold, wood rot, or sagging, and to consider if there have been recent changes in the property’s use or environment that may contribute to the issue. Clear information about the location and condition of the beams can assist in determining the appropriate repair approach and ensuring the project addresses the root cause of the problem.

Signs Of Support Beam Damage
Sagging floors, cracked walls, and uneven ceilings can indicate compromised support beams.
Common Causes Of Beam Issues
Wood rot, termite damage, and structural stress are frequent reasons for support beam deterioration.
Repair Options For Support Beams
Reinforcement, replacement, or sistering are typical methods to restore structural stability in wilmington homes.

Support Beam Repair Questions
What are support beams used for? Support beams provide essential stability to a building’s structure, helping to carry weight and prevent sagging or collapse.
How can I tell if a support beam needs repair? Signs include sagging flo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, or unusual creaking sounds near the beams.
What types of projects typically require support beam repair? Support beam repair is common in home renovations, foundation repairs, or after structural damage from storms or settling.
